Since its doors opened in 1984, the Rolex building has been an Uptown landmark. Recently, construction was completed on the lobby area and a seventh floor penthouse added to offer additional office space with garden and arena views. This expansion has allowed new tenants to join long-term tenants many of whom have been in the building since its opening. The building features an atrium-style lobby centered around a fountain with an impressive Rolex clock rising above it that is accessible from a front circular drive, the parking garage, and the International Center Gardens via a skybridge.
The Rolex Building, the first phase of development at Harwood International Center, overlooks a 1.5 acre European-style garden which was constructed in 1996 to cleverly disguise the Centex Building's garage.
